Transaction 91c5b3c8349ac62da256afb3170e9da35508d6cdebb103f38ea0bcbb528d090e
1 Input
1 Output
-
91c5b3c8349ac62da256afb3170e9da35508d6cdebb103f38ea0bcbb528d090e:0
- value
- 640488
- script pubkey
- OP_0 OP_PUSHBYTES_20 fb028248f33d7ae4a7a8e4e85c1198a6668e2467
- address
- bc1qlvpgyj8n84awffagun59cyvc5engufr842egfd